Scheduling

If you plan to have one or two meals catered every week, you may be able to work with your caterer on getting a better price. When you guarantee your caterer the business and your caterer knows far in advance what meals they will be preparing for you, they may be willing to discount some of the meals. When the caterer can plan and prepare ahead of time, it is better for their schedule and their budget. They can pass these savings on to you!

Be Flexible

Let your caterer choose while meals they deliver to you and you will surely have a more budget friendly outcome. If you allow your caterer the freedom to create your meals, they can choose produce and meats that are fresher, in season and therefore more economical. On the other hand, if you request a strawberry tart in the middle of the winter when strawberries are at their peak cost, well, your bill is going to be high! Let your caterer know that you want delicious food on a budget and let them have free reign from there. You won’t be disappointed in the food or the cost.

Pick Up

Having a catered meal doesn’t have to mean having the food delivered to your door. While this is, of course, a nicety when having a catered meal. You can save a lot of money by opting to pick up the food yourself. Your caterer will have your meal ready and waiting for you at your specified time and you will save money on delivery and set up fees.
